Fatal Kershaw County, S.C. drowning death of David Cunningham

The official identification of the deceased person from last Sunday’s incident at Lake Wateree has been announced by the local Coroner’s Office. David West, the head of the Kershaw County Coroner’s Office, formally identified the deceased as a 62-year-old resident from Lancaster County named David Cunningham.

According to the authorities involved, the drowning tragedy began when the victim made the decision to enter the water from a boat. This decision was made around 2:50 p.m. in the vicinity of the dam. Following his initial emergence from the water, there were reports from officials indicating that the man submerged again before help arrived.

A coordinated search operation was launched promptly. Responders from multiple agencies joined forces in the rescue efforts. These agencies included the Kershaw County Fire Service, the South Carolina Department of Natural Resources, and the Kershaw County Sheriff’s Office. Their combined expertise was crucial in the ongoing search for the missing person.

Tragically, the search culminated in the recovery of the body. Specialized divers successfully located the deceased. This solemn discovery took place at approximately 10:45 p.m. on the night of the incident, bringing an end to the urgent search that had been underway for several hours.
